Notes:

The above list covers most of the sections applicable for domestic transactions.

Section 397(2) | Earlier Section 206AA

(a) No matter what is mentioned in any other provision of the Income Tax Act, any person who is receiving an amount on which TDS is deducted or making a payment on which TCS is collected must provide a valid PAN to the person responsible for deducting or collecting tax.

(b) If PAN is not provided:

(i) Tax must be deducted at the higher of the following rates:

(A) the rate mentioned in the relevant section of the Act; or

(B) the rate or rates currently in force; or

(C) 5% where tax is required to be deducted under Section 393(1) [Table: Sl. No. 8(ii) or 8(v)], or 20% in all other cases.

Note: 

  • 5% tax applies to payments to e-commerce participants or to specific transactions under the 2025 Act.
  • Sl. No. 8(v) – E-commerce: No deduction is required if the e-commerce participant is an individual/HUF, sales are under ₹5,00,000, and a PAN/Aadhaar is provided.

Notes:
The above list covers most of the sections applicable for domestic transactions.

Section 397(2) | Earlier Section 206CC

(a) No matter what is mentioned in any other provision of the Income Tax Act, every person receiving an amount on which TDS is deducted, or making a payment on which TCS is collected, must provide a valid PAN to the person deducting or collecting tax.

(b) If PAN is not provided:

(ii) TCS will be collected at the higher of the following rates, subject to a maximum of 20%:

(A) Twice the rate mentioned under the relevant provision of the Act, or

(B) 5%
